Stepping back, the overall craftsmanship on this "Air Jordan 1 Low Travis Scott" pair is impressive. Stitching is clean, the suede nap is consistent, and the midsole paint is neat. For a mass-produced sneaker, it feels special. That attention to detail is what separates a great collab from a good one. It feels like you're getting a complete product, not just a logo swap.
